The yachts arriving at Ter Heide, 9 December 1677

The yachts arriving at Ter Heide, 29 November [OS]/9 December 1677.

On the left, a port quarter view of the ‘Mary’ (Marije) with a barge pulling alongport, bringing the Prince (de prins komt aende Marij). On her starboard beam, a port broadside view of the ‘Charlotte’ (de siarlet) with a pink and barge alongside in which the ‘Princess’ is about to leave; a man at the masthead to strike the standard (identified by the inscription: zijn hoogh gaet uit de siarlet). Astern of the ‘Charlotte’, the ‘Katherine’ (de katarijne) and further away, the ‘Portsmouth’ (de portsmout). A pink in the right foreground, pulls towards the ‘Charlotte’. On the right is the ‘Saudadoes’ (de soldaet) and on the left, the ‘Charles’ (de siarlet).
